Enter your dates for the latest hotel rates and availability.
161 hotels
30 hotels
5 hotels
18 hotels
17 hotels
334 hotels
37 hotels
12 hotels
3 hotels
50 hotels
49 hotels
61 hotels
31 hotels
25 hotels
16,881 hotels
6,093 hotels
30,204 hotels
1,459 hotels
17,825 hotels
2,904 hotels
2,672 hotels
5,735 hotels
2,508 hotels
4,107 hotels